Why the C:N Ratio Matters
Compost is powered by microorganisms. These microbes need:
- Carbon for energy
- Nitrogen for protein growth
If there’s too much nitrogen:
- The pile smells bad
- It can turn slimy
- It may become anaerobic
If there’s too much carbon:
- Decomposition slows down
- The pile stays dry
- It may sit for months without breaking down
Ideal Compost C:N Ratio
The ideal compost C:N ratio is:
25:1 to 30:1
That means:
- 25–30 parts carbon
- 1 part nitrogen
This range supports fast, efficient composting.
Greens vs Browns (Simple Breakdown)
Green Materials (Nitrogen-Rich)
Lower C:N ratio:
- Food scraps (15:1)
- Fresh grass clippings (20:1)
- Chicken manure (10:1)
- Cow manure (18:1)
These heat up your pile.
Brown Materials (Carbon-Rich)
Higher C:N ratio:
- Dry leaves (170:1)
- Straw (80:1)
- Shredded cardboard (350:1)
- Sawdust (500:1)
These provide structure and airflow.
How the Compost Calculator Works
The calculator uses three key pieces of data:
- Material C:N ratio
- Material density (weight per gallon)
- Volume entered by you
Step-by-Step Process
For each material:
- Volume × Density = Estimated weight
- Weight is divided into carbon and nitrogen portions
- All carbon is added together
- All nitrogen is added together
- Final ratio = Total Carbon ÷ Total Nitrogen
Then it compares your result to composting standards.

Understanding the Results
The calculator sorts results into four categories.
1. Nitrogen Heavy (Too Green)
Ratio below 20:1
What happens:
- Strong smell
- Wet texture
- Poor airflow
Fix:
Add browns like:
- Sawdust
- Leaves
- Cardboard
2. Carbon Heavy (Too Brown)
Ratio above 40:1
What happens:
- Slow decomposition
- Little heat
- Dry pile
Fix:
Add greens like:
- Grass clippings
- Food scraps
- Manure
3. Optimal Balance
Ratio between 25:1 and 30:1
This is perfect.
You can expect:
- Strong microbial activity
- Fast breakdown
- Good heat generation
4. Acceptable Range
Ratio between 20:1–25:1 or 30:1–40:1
This still works well.
Just monitor moisture and turn the pile regularly.

Why Density Matters
Many people overlook density.
One gallon of sawdust does not weigh the same as one gallon of leaves.
The calculator accounts for:
- Material weight
- Carbon content
- Nitrogen content
This makes the compost ratio more accurate than simple volume guesses.
Common Compost Problems (And How the Calculator Helps)
Compost Smells Bad
Likely too much nitrogen.
Use the calculator to increase browns.
Compost Isn’t Heating
Probably too carbon-heavy.
Add greens and recalculate.
Compost Is Slimy
Nitrogen overload or poor airflow.
Balance the C:N ratio first.
Tips for Better Composting
- Keep moisture like a wrung-out sponge
- Turn the pile every 1–2 weeks
- Chop large materials smaller
- Avoid adding too much sawdust at once
- Don’t overload with manure
Even with a perfect C:N ratio, moisture and oxygen still matter.

Important Note About Accuracy
The calculator uses average C:N values and average densities.
Real-world values vary depending on:
- Moisture level
- Source of material
- Age of material
Treat results as strong estimates, not lab results.
